01. Wood Fences: The Allure of Nature

Pros: natural charm, easy to obtain, easy to install, easy to process.

Cons: susceptible to insect infestation, decay, and require regular maintenance, poor environmental impact.

Exploring 5 Fence Materials For Your Backyard - wood fence

Wooden fences are the most common and traditional choice because wood is a highly accessible material. They offer a timeless charm that seamlessly blends with natural surroundings. Nothing compares to the natural softness and luster of a wood fence. The most sought-after wood for fencing is cedar. Redwood and teak are also good materials, except for their high price, so they are better suited for small fencing projects. Remember, every wood fence requires regular maintenance, such as painting, staining, and sealing to keep it looking good. And if you are a wood lover and don’t mind staining and sealing every two years, go for wood fencing.  

Wood Fence Rotting
Without regular maintenance, a wood fence is prone to rot and will affect the beauty of your backyard.

02. Bamboo Fences: The Green Alternative

Pros: environmentally friendly, lightweight, easy to install , cheap

Cons: low strength, insect infestation and mold growth

Exploring 5 Fence Materials For Your Backyard - bamboo fence

Bamboo regenerates very quickly and has been considered an environmentally friendly material since ancient times. Like wood, it also gives a natural feeling. It’s usually lightweight and easy to install. Nonetheless, bamboo’s relatively low strength compared to other materials limits its applications in high-stress environments. Regular inspections for insect infestation and mold growth are also necessary.

Mold bamboo fence
Bamboo is susceptible to mold. Therefore, it is not recommended to use it in areas with high rainfall and humidity.

03. Metal Fences: Synonymous with strength

Pros: excellent strength, durability

Cons: heavy, may rust, need painting

Exploring 5 Fence Materials For Your Backyard - Metal fence

Metal fences is also a common fence option. And the most common metal is steel because it embodies great strength, durability to safeguard your property for decades. Their high security features and recyclability are noteworthy. It also have various design styles to meet different house needs. However, iron’s susceptibility to rust necessitates regular painting, adding to maintenance costs. Moreover, their weight and installation complexity can be daunting, and their visual austerity may not suit all preferences.

Over time, if you don't maintain your steel fence correctly, the rust-proof layer may fall off, and you will end up with an ugly rusted fence.

04. PVC Fences: Modern Style

Pros: waterproof, low maintenance, diverse styles.

Cons: high price, artificial appearance, deformation under big temperature changes

Exploring 5 Fence Materials For Your Backyard - PVC fence

PVC fences is a modern fence material. It’s made of all plastic, so it boasts excellent waterproof and corrosion-resistant properties, making it virtually maintenance-free. It comes in vibrant colors, and white is the most common one. Besides, its diverse styles and easy cleaning features contribute to their appeal. Nonetheless, PVC’s artificial appearance may not resonate with everyone, and extreme temperatures can cause deformation.

05. Wood Plastic Composite Fences: The Innovative Fusion

Pros: wood-like appearance, plastic’s waterproofing and durablity.

Cons: initial cost is higher than wood, heavy, may deform slightly after huge temperature changes.

Exploring 5 Fence Materials For Your Backyard - WPC fence

Wood plastic composite fences represent a groundbreaking innovation, combining the aesthetic appeal of wood with the durability of plastic. Crafted from wood fibers and thermoplastic resins, WPC fences offer a long service life while require minimal maintenance. Their resistance to water, insects, and decay makes ownership hassle-free. WPC fences are eco-friendly, as they utilize recycled materials and can be recycled themselves. Furthermore, WPC is designed to replace wood, so it tries to mimic various wood grains and colors. Sometimes you cannot even distinguish which is wood and which is WPC from a relatively far viewpoint. If you like wood fence but don’t like the tedious and frequent maintenance work for wood fence, then WPC is your best option.

WPC fence usually keeps good conditions after years.

While the initial investment in WPC fences may be slightly higher than some traditional materials, their long-term cost-effectiveness, considering reduced maintenance and replacement costs, makes them a sound financial decision.
